SHOW ALL WORK. The specific gravity of silver (Ag) is 10.5. Determine the number
of Ag atoms in a small sphere of pure Ag with a radius of 0.00150 inch. (Note: The volume of a
sphere of radius R equals (4/3)R3.)
(4 points)
R = (0.00150 in) (2.54 cm/in) = 0.00381 cm
V = (4/3) (3.1416) (0.00381 cm)3 = 2.316 x 10-7 cm3
(2.316 x 10-7 cm3) (10.5 g/cm3) (1 mole Ag / 107.87 g) (6.022 x 1023 atoms/mole)
= 1.36 x 1016 Ag atoms

SHOW ALL WORK. Aluminum carbide, a high-tech ceramic material, is a binary
compound of aluminum and carbon. When a 2.011-g sample of aluminum carbide was completely
combusted with oxygen, 2.850 g of solid Al2O3 (molar mass = 101.9) was produced along with an
undetermined quantity of CO2 gas. Determine the empirical formula of aluminum carbide. (Note:
To receive any partial credit, you must use the mole concept!)
(5 points)
(2.850 g Al2O3) (1 mole / 101.9 g) (2 mole Al / 1 mole Al2O3) = 0.05594 mole Al
(0.05594 mole Al) (26.98 g/mole) = 1.509 g Al
mass C = 2.011 g sample - 1.509 g Al = 0.5018 g C
(0.5018 g C) (1 mole / 12.01 g) = 0.04178 mole C
Al0.05594 C0.04178 = Al1.33 C = Al3C4
